Northwest Career College
Las Vegas, Nevada — 7398 Smoke Ranch Road, Ste 100, 89128
Northwest Career College is a leading Private for-profit institution located in Las Vegas, Nevada. Established to provide high-quality education, Northwest Career College offers a range of programs and is recognized for its commitment to student success and academic excellence in the United States region.
| Federal Aid Approval | 9/14/2004 |
|---|---|
| Location | Las Vegas, Nevada |
| Type | Private for-profit |
| Total Enrollment | 2,222 students |
| Median Salary | $27,530 |

Student Debt Overview
| Median Debt — Completers | $9,500 |
| Cumulative Debt — 25th Percentile | $4,750 |
| Cumulative Debt — 75th Percentile | $9,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Northwest Career College
What is the acceptance rate at Northwest Career College?
Acceptance rate data for Northwest Career College is not reported in the 2026 U.S. Department of Education dataset.
How much is tuition at Northwest Career College?
Tuition at Northwest Career College is $14,842 per year. Net price and financial aid options may reduce this cost significantly depending on individual circumstances.
What is the average salary for graduates of Northwest Career College?
Graduates of Northwest Career College earn a median salary of $27,530 per year, based on 2026 U.S. Department of Education earnings data.
Where is Northwest Career College located?
Northwest Career College is located at 7398 Smoke Ranch Road, Ste 100, Las Vegas, Nevada 89128. The campus is situated in the United States region of the United States.
